.glass-surface{position:relative;display:flex;align-items:center;justify-content:center;overflow:hidden;transition:opacity .26s ease-out}.glass-surface__filter{width:100%;height:100%;pointer-events:none;position:absolute;inset:0;opacity:0;z-index:-1}.glass-surface__content{width:100%;height:100%;display:flex;align-items:center;justify-content:center;padding:.5rem;border-radius:inherit;position:relative;z-index:1}.glass-surface--svg{background:light-dark(hsl(0 0% 100%/var(--glass-frost,0)),hsl(0 0% 0%/var(--glass-frost,0)));backdrop-filter:var(--filter-id,url(#glass-filter)) saturate(var(--glass-saturation,1)) blur(12px);box-shadow:inset 0 0 2px 1px light-dark(color-mix(in oklch,#000,transparent 85%),color-mix(in oklch,#fff,transparent 65%)),inset 0 0 10px 4px light-dark(color-mix(in oklch,#000,transparent 90%),color-mix(in oklch,#fff,transparent 85%)),0 4px 16px rgba(17,17,26,.05),0 8px 24px rgba(17,17,26,.05),0 16px 56px rgba(17,17,26,.05),inset 0 4px 16px rgba(17,17,26,.05),inset 0 8px 24px rgba(17,17,26,.05),inset 0 16px 56px rgba(17,17,26,.05)}.glass-surface--fallback{background:rgba(0,0,0,.6);backdrop-filter:blur(12px) saturate(1.8) brightness(1.1);-webkit-backdrop-filter:blur(12px) saturate(1.8) brightness(1.1);border:none;box-shadow:0 8px 32px 0 rgba(0,0,0,.4),0 2px 16px 0 rgba(0,0,0,.2)}@media (prefers-color-scheme:dark){.glass-surface--fallback{background:rgba(0,0,0,.7);backdrop-filter:blur(12px) saturate(1.8) brightness(1.2);-webkit-backdrop-filter:blur(12px) saturate(1.8) brightness(1.2);border:none;box-shadow:0 8px 32px 0 rgba(0,0,0,.5),0 2px 16px 0 rgba(0,0,0,.3)}}@supports not (backdrop-filter:blur(10px)){.glass-surface--fallback{background:rgba(0,0,0,.8)}.glass-surface--fallback:before{content:"";position:absolute;inset:0;background:rgba(0,0,0,.2);border-radius:inherit;z-index:-1}@media (prefers-color-scheme:dark){.glass-surface--fallback{background:rgba(0,0,0,.9)}.glass-surface--fallback:before{background:rgba(0,0,0,.4)}}}.glass-surface:focus-visible{outline:2px solid light-dark(#007aff,#0a84ff);outline-offset:2px}.liquid-bubble-glow{background:radial-gradient(circle at 50% 0,hsl(var(--primary)/.15) 0,transparent 70%),radial-gradient(circle at 50% 100%,hsl(var(--primary)/.08) 0,transparent 70%);box-shadow:0 -2px 10px hsl(var(--primary)/.1),0 2px 10px hsl(var(--primary)/.05),inset 0 0 15px hsl(var(--primary)/.05)}.liquid-bubble-edge{position:absolute;inset:0;border-radius:inherit;padding:1px;mask:linear-gradient(#fff 0 0) content-box,linear-gradient(#fff 0 0);mask-composite:xor;-webkit-mask-composite:exclude;pointer-events:none}.liquid-bubble-edge:before{content:"";position:absolute;inset:-20px;background:conic-gradient(from 0deg at 50% 50%,transparent 0deg,hsl(var(--primary)/.3) 120deg,hsl(var(--primary)/.6) 180deg,hsl(var(--primary)/.3) 240deg,transparent 1turn);filter:blur(2px);animation:rotate-glow 4s linear infinite}@keyframes rotate-glow{0%{transform:rotate(0deg)}to{transform:rotate(1turn)}}